I've married the TPA6304 EVM board to my recently-minted "break-out board".
I might have made a design mistake assuming that TPA6304's IN_M voltage rail is ~3.3VDC as the earlier TAS5414 was.
But I'm measuring IN_M at 2.6VDC under the load of a 10M ohm scope probe.
Is this correct?
The IN_M voltage is significant to me because I bring it into my board, buffer it with a high impedance input unity gain stage, and then bias all of my pre-TPA6304 circuitry around the buffered voltage.
